Neural Networks: A Comprehensive Guide to Machine Learning Architectures
Artificial neural networks has revolutionized various industries, from healthcare to finance. Forming the core of this transformation are neural networks, complex computational models inspired by the structure and function of the human brain. These architectures consist of interconnected nodes, or neurons, organized into layers.
Data flows through these layers, undergoing transformations at each connection, ultimately resulting in a desired output. There are various types of neural network architectures, each suited for unique tasks. Some popular examples include convolutional neural networks (CNNs), recurrent neural networks (RNNs), and transformer networks.
- Convolutional neural networks excel at image recognition.
- RNNs are particularly adept at handling time-series, making them ideal for tasks like speech recognition.
- Transformer networks have achieved remarkable results in language modeling due to their ability to capture long-range dependencies within text.
Understanding the different types of neural network architectures is crucial for choosing the most appropriate model for a given machine learning problem. Optimizing Neural Network Performance for Enhanced Natural Language Processing Tasks
Achieving optimal performance in natural language processing (NLP) tasks necessitates meticulous tuning and optimization of neural network architectures. By employing a combination of strategies, developers can dramatically enhance the accuracy, efficiency, and robustness of NLP models. Fundamental among these strategies are techniques such as hyperparameter tuning, architectural modification, and data augmentation. Hyperparameter optimization encompasses systematically adjusting parameters like learning rate, batch size, and activation functions, while architectural modifications investigate unique network configurations to improve pattern recognition. Data augmentation, on the other hand, expands the training dataset by creating synthetic examples, thereby reducing overfitting and improving generalization ability.
